Heat and hot water is supplied to South Gardens under a district heating network operated by E.ON Heat.
Two gas-fired CHP (Combined Heat and Power) plants each produce 800kW of electrical energy inside the Energy Centre on the corner of Heygate Street and Rodney Road. The waste heat from electricity generation is then used to heat homes and businesses through underground pipes which pump hot water to where it is needed.
The Energy Centre supplies heat to the entire Elephant Park development, including the new Shopping Centre (when it opens). The district heat network has the potential to extend beyond Elephant Park.
Registering with E.ON Energy
Billing for heat and hot water is managed by E.ON Heat, which is responsible for providing the service. To ensure an uninterrupted service, make sure to register with E.ON Heat on the E.ON Energy website here.
E.ON Energy offers four different tariffs which you can see in the table below. Your usage is automatically metered by E.ON based on your address.
As this is a district heat network, it is not possible to sign up with other providers.
The current heat tariffs from Eon Heat for 1st April 2026 – 31st March 2027 are:
| 2026-2027 | Standing charge (£ per year) | Unit price (p/kWh) |
|---|---|---|
| Heat 1 | £159.63 | 33.01p |
| Heat 2 | £577.78 | 9.57p |
| Heat 3 | £462.22 | 11.05p |
| Heat 4 | £520 | 9.51p |
You can switch tariffs by contacting Eon by email heat@eon-uk.com and including you account number.
The best tariff depends on your usage. This year, the cheapest tariffs by usage are:
| Annual usage | Cheapest tariff |
|---|---|
| Below ~1,380 kWh | Heat 1 |
| ~1,380 – ~3,750 kWh | Heat 3 |
| Above ~3,750 kWh | Heat 4 |
Heat 2 is never the cheapest option. Heat 4 beats it at every usage level – it has both a lower unit rate (9.51p vs 9.57p) and a lower standing charge (£520 vs £577.78), so there’s no crossover point.
